May 13, 2026

Routine

Score: 922 violations

4-2A - food stored covered

Regulation: 511-6-1.04(4)(c)1(iv) - packaged & unpackaged food, food stored covered(c)

4 ptsCorrected: YesRepeat: No

Observed two containers with food (wonton, butter sauce 137F) being stored uncovered on shelve in grill area at the time of this inspection. COS: Items covered. Even though butter sauce was in temp EH instructs manager to ensure that butter sauce is kept under temperature control to avoid contamination. CA: All food must be stored covered.

8-2B - toxic substances properly identified, stored, used

Regulation: 511-6-1.07(6)(c) - storage, separation (p)

4 ptsCorrected: YesRepeat: No

Observed a spray sanitizer being stored on counter with clean glasses in bar area at the time of this inspection. COS: Sanitizer removed. CA: Poisonous or toxic materials shall be stored so they cannot contaminate food, equipment, utensils, linens, and single-service and single-use articles by separating the poisonous or toxic materials by spacing or partitioning and locating the poisonous or toxic materials in an area that is not above food, equipment, utensils, linens, and single-service or single-use articles.

Oct 20, 2025

Routine

Score: 961 violation

2-2D - adequate handwashing facilities supplied & accessible

Regulation: 511-6-1.06(2)(o) - using a handwashing sink- operation & maintenance (pf)

4 ptsCorrected: YesRepeat: No

Observed handwashing sink in bar area was used to dump a drink and orange peels, as well as handwashing sink in main kitchen used to store sanitizer bucket at the time of this inspection. COS: Management removed items from both handwashing sinks. CA: A handwashing facility may not be used for purposes other than handwashing

May 31, 2024

Routine

Score: 911 violation

6-1A - proper cold holding temperatures

Regulation: 511-6-1.04(6)(f) - time/temperature control for safety; cold holding (p)

9 ptsCorrected: NoRepeat: No

Observed temperature controlled for safety food items (Pico de gallo, crab cake mix, American cheese, cut cucumbers, sliced tomatoes) in prep top cooler (in front of the flat top grill in kitchen) were being stored above the allowed 41 F at the time of this inspection. CA: Manager stated the unit would be serviced today, and proceeded to discard all TCS items. Time/temperature control for safety food shall be maintained at 41°F (5°C) or below when stored.

Oct 19, 2023

Routine

Score: 971 violation

11C - approved thawing methods used

Regulation: 511-6-1.04(6)(c) - thawing (c)

3 ptsCorrected: YesRepeat: No

Observed during the course of this inspection that staff pull a block of Reduced Oxygen Packaged tuna to begin the thawing process in the cooler without removing the fish from the package or introducing oxygen to the environment. COS: Management immediately removed the fish from the package. CA: Management stated that all staff will be trained to remove all ROP fish from the reduced oxygen environment before thawing.
